Dagestan head Sergei Melikov told that refereeing errors of the current season affect the state of the teams, noting that there can be no talk of a decrease in the overall level of work of referees.
The match of the 3rd round of the RPL between Dynamo Makhachkala and Paris NN (victory of Nizhny Novgorod with a score of 1:0) caused a lot of discussion. Dynamo general director Shamil Gazizov suggested testing referee Yan Bobrovsky with a lie detector, “so that this judge would never judge.” After the meeting, it was announced that referees Bobrovsky and Rafael Shafeev (VAR referee) would not receive assignments for the upcoming matches. The expert judicial commission under the RFU president decided that Bobrovsky had mistakenly awarded a penalty to the Makhachkala team in the 78th minute after a video review, but on the remaining verdicts, the commission sided with the referee.
— Shamil Gazizov had an emotional reaction after the match against Paris NN. What do you think about the judging this season?
“I had the same reaction. I can’t say that refereeing is getting worse. I believe that sometimes refereeing mistakes affect not only the score on the scoreboard, but also the state of the team. Everyone must be responsible for the general state of our football,” Melikov told .
In August, Dynamo Makhachkala published a letter to the RFU asking to pay special attention to the problem of refereeing and to develop solutions that will help improve the quality of referees’ work during matches.
Earlier in Moscow, a meeting took place between representatives of the MIR clubs of the Russian Premier League (RPL) with the head of the RFU refereeing and inspection department Milorad Mazhich and the president of the RFU ESC Pavel Kamantsev.
